Handover for tonight's on-call covering the Fleetmark timing-chip reader at the Corvane Valley Marathon. The reader array at the finish line was flaky this afternoon — antenna three dropped out twice and recovered on its own. If it drops again, fail over to the backup mat rather than rebooting mid-race; reboots lose up to thirty seconds of reads. Raw chip data is buffered locally, so results can be replayed afterward. The failover procedure and replay instructions are documented on the page below.

runbook for badug-kadup: https://confluence.zemvarlabs.internal/projects/browse/display/projects/bd1b

**Ticket PARITY-412: Kestrel SDK catch-up**

Quick one for the weekly sync: the Kestrel-Go SDK is still missing batched uploads and retry hints that Kestrel-JS shipped two releases ago. Partner teams keep asking. Plan is to land both behind a flag this sprint and cut a minor release. Needs a sign-off from the owner named below.

account owner for bajef-badup: Drueth Kelath Pelael Holwyn

Subject: Hiring freeze — Ardent Logistics division (details for finance)

Team,

Effective the first of next month, the Ardent Logistics division will pause all external hiring. Finance should freeze associated requisition budgets, reclassify unspent recruitment funds to the contingency line, and flag any committed agency fees by Friday. Internal transfers remain permitted with VP approval. Forecast models should assume flat headcount through year-end. The confidential planning context appears below.

management briefing: Jorixax Holdings is in early talks to buy Casixax Holdings for about $420.3 million. The Fenmir launch date is October 27, and nothing goes to the press before then. Legal wants the Keloxek Foods term sheet redrafted before April 16.

CI note: the Gridwhistle crossword generator job has been flaking on the symmetry check since Tuesday. Cause is a nondeterministic word-list shuffle seeded from wall-clock time; under load the seed collides and the solver deadlocks, hitting the 10-minute timeout. Workaround: retry the stage once; permanent fix is pinning the seed, tracked in the backlog. If you see the failure again, confirm it matches the build token below.

pipeline stamp: htk4_c337